What is Local SEO?
Local SEO, or local search engine optimisation, is the process of improving your website and online presence so your business ranks higher in search results for geographically targeted keywords. If someone in Milton Keynes types “best coffee shop near me” or “ecommerce website design Milton Keynes”, Google wants to show them results that are both relevant and local.
Unlike traditional SEO, which targets broad audiences, local SEO zeroes in on people searching in your immediate area. This makes it particularly valuable for start-ups and small businesses competing against larger national brands.

Step 1: Set Up and Optimise Google Business Profile
Your Google Business Profile (GBP) is often the first impression a potential customer will have of your business. For new businesses in Milton Keynes, setting this up properly is essential.
- Add accurate business details including name, address, phone number and website.
- Select the most relevant categories for your services such as web design in Milton Keynes or ecommerce website design.
- Upload professional images to build trust.
- Encourage satisfied customers to leave reviews, as these directly influence rankings.
A well-optimised GBP not only boosts your local SEO but also increases calls, website visits and directions requests.
Step 2: Optimise Your Website for Local Keywords
Your website is the foundation of all digital marketing activity. For businesses in Milton Keynes, it is important to use location-specific keywords in a natural way. For example, if you provide web development or local SEO services Milton Keynes, ensure your location is clear across landing pages, service descriptions and metadata.
Some best practices include:
- Creating dedicated service pages for offerings like ecommerce website design or web development in Milton Keynes.
- Adding your city and region naturally in titles, headings and body content.
- Ensuring your contact details are consistent across the site.
- Embedding a Google Map on your contact page for stronger geo-signals.
Step 3: Build Local Citations and Listings
Citations are online mentions of your business name, address and phone number. Consistency is crucial. Make sure your details match across platforms such as Yelp, Thomson Local, Yell and local directories in Milton Keynes.
This not only strengthens your authority with search engines but also makes it easier for potential customers to contact you.

Step 6: Earn Reviews and Build Trust
Positive reviews can transform your local visibility. They not only influence search rankings but also reassure potential customers that you are credible. Encourage clients to leave feedback on Google and industry platforms. Always respond to reviews, whether positive or constructive.
